Deneshia Faulkner will bring in her first recruiting class in 2024-25 as she begins her second season.
 
The Heidelberg native was introduced as Jones' 13th head women's basketball coach in May 2023 after a successful five-year stint at Meridian High School where she guided the Lady Wildcats to their first MHSAA girls' championship in 2021-22.

Faulkner is familiar with Jones having played at Heidelberg and she has sent several players to play for the Bobcats in recent years.

She led the Lady Oilers to an undefeated regular season – the first in 25 years at HHS – with their only loss coming in the MHSAA championship game. Faulkner was also instrumental in helping HHS students achieve high English scores on the state standardized tests. 

After serving 11 years as a high school coach, Faulkner is most proud of the fact that 100 percent of her players have graduated, 23 have earned athletic scholarships and four have enlisted in the nation's Armed Forces.
 
Faulkner went to Alabama State University and won six SWAC championships in track and field between 2000 and 2004. She studied English and Language Arts at ASU and then went to William Carey University where she received a bachelor's degree in English with a minor in education.
 
After graduating from Carey, she became an English teacher and then head coach at Heidelberg High School.
 
Faulkner is married to former Jones College basketball player Scottie Faulkner and they have two daughters, Raygan and Riley.
